Casita Del Campo is a vibrant Mexican restaurant nestled in Los Angeles, perfect for gatherings with friends or special occasions. With over 30 years of experience under the same management, it boasts a sunny patio surrounded by umbrellas, offering a lively yet relaxed atmosphere. Patrons rave about the unique seafood dishes and the cozy ambiance highlighted by a stunning interior featuring a giant tree. The friendly staff are known for their exceptional service, making every visit memorable. Whether for a casual meal or a private event, Casita Del Campo continues to delight guests with delicious flavors and a welcoming environment.

Best words to describe this restaurant is could have should have been. It has all the right ingredients to be a 4- 4-1/2 star experience. The food is good, not great but headed in the right direction. Due to its price I surely expect a bit more of flavor. When you order you get a choice of a salad or soup, the waiter brought albondigas. The broth was 7/10 but the meat was a 3/10. The enchiladas were good. 8/10 what blew my mind was the cucumber/lemon agua Fresca 10/10 wow factor. I recommend the patio setting, and perfect for a romantic evening. Unfortunately, the waitstaff was too busy and too way too long after we finished our meal. I will say, he did go above and beyond with allowing me to take my beverage home in a To- go cup.
